Output 803aef30989b624875440813a35387d23e06a6697e764723b5f6a5a7ba52c258:1

value
125000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d51a37f824195c5dcea41c843e62b1e758ac37 OP_EQUAL
address
3D54zwqHHBxSHtGKTAq2oEHtDEUnnpSCw6
transaction
803aef30989b624875440813a35387d23e06a6697e764723b5f6a5a7ba52c258
confirmations
358114
spent
true